Taryn Kateridge (Medford, NY/Patchogue-Medford) scored a 9.625 on the floor exercise leading The College at Brockport Gymnastics team to a 186.000-181.525 victory over Division II West Chester University Saturday afternoon at the Tuttle North Gymnastics Center in Brockport.
Kateridge won the event and the next four spots were also filled by Golden Eagles.
Taylor Wierzba (Hamburg, NY/Hamburg) was second with a 9.6 followed by freshman
Amanda Carney (Walpole, MA/Walpole), senior
Kileigh Chapman (Gansevoort, NY/South Glens Falls) and junior
Elizabeth Levy (Glen Allen, PA/Hermitage) who each score 9.525 in the event for Brockport (3-2).
Brockport won all four events with a high score of 47.800 on the floor.
“I was happy at the way we bounced back today,” said head coach
John Feeney. “We had a rough start on the uneven bars and later put together an unbelievable score on the floor.”
Sophomore Gabrielle Pettito (Seldon, NY/Newfield) won the vault with a personal best score of 9.475 and Levy was second with a 9.45. Carney tied for fourth with a 9.375.
Chapman won the bars with a 9.35 and Levy was second at 9.25. Freshman
Natalie Manga (Fresh Meadows, NY/Benjamin N. Cardozo) was tied for fourth with a 9.1.
West Chester (5-1) won the balance beam individual title but Brockport finished with the next five spots led by senior
Colleen Chahbazi (Flushing, MI/Flushing) and junior
Kelcie Morris (Hagerstown, MD/Smithsburg) each scoring a 9.35, sophomore
Heidi Beckerich (Indianapolis, IN/Bishop Chatard) scoring a 9.3, Wierzba adding a 9.2 and Levy posting a 9.125.
